This is mostly a maintenance release. As a new feature, the filtration model now co-filters and respires. This release was used in the latest revision of the paper "Slavik, K., Lemmen, C., Zhang, W., Kerimoglu, O., Klingbeil, K., Wirtz, K.W., 2018. The large scale impact of offshore windfarm structures on pelagic primary productivity in the southern North Sea. Revised version submitted to Hydrobiologia"
